"The Gates" Augmented Reality Experience and Exhibition
Booking Through: Sunday, March 23 2025
2025 marks the 20th anniversary of The Gates, Christo and Jeanne-Claude’s monumental work of temporary public art. Installed in Central Park in February 2005, the artwork consisted of 7,503 saffron-colored gates adorned with free-flowing fabric that spanned 23 miles of pathways and transformed the iconic park. To celebrate the project’s anniversary, the Christo and Jeanne-Claude Foundation, along with The Shed, Central Park Conservancy, NYC Parks, and Bloomberg Philanthropies, will launch a major exhibition at The Shed in Hudson Yards and an augmented reality (AR) experience in Central Park powered by Bloomberg Connects.
AUGMENTED REALITY EXPERIENCE IN CENTRAL PARK
The Gates will also be reimagined through one of the most ambitious art augmented reality experiences ever created in Central Park, which can be accessed for free on the Bloomberg Connects mobile app. The innovative technology, developed collaboratively by the Christo and Jeanne-Claude Foundation, Dirt Empire, and Superbright, will allow park visitors to relive the iconic 2005 installation by using their mobile device as a portal to see a section of The Gates where they once stood. Throughout the journey, visitors will also be cued to engage with simple interactive stories and information that convey the history of The Gates project.

Show Up, Kids!
Booking Through: Saturday, March 15 2025
Following capacity crowds and raves from NYC to Edinburgh to Hollywood, the interactive family comedy "Show Up, Kids!” makes its Brooklyn debut at The Rat NYC in DUMBO at 2:00 p.m. on Saturday afternoons from January 25-March 15 (no show on Feb 1). This semi-improvised musical show for kids 3-10 years old puts a wildly comedic twist on the traditional kids’ show. When the main attraction doesn’t show up, the host enlists the help of the kids (and their grownups) to control everything from plot to props, characters to costumes, and settings to sound in a one-of-a-kind, 45-minute laughfest.

Luna Luna (NYC)
Booking Through: Sunday, March 16 2025
Luna Luna: Forgotten Fantasy invites visitors into a colorful, riotous fun house of carnival attractions by visionary artists of the 20th century including Jean-Michel Basquiat, Sonia Delaunay, Keith Haring, David Hockney, Roy Lichtenstein, and more.
The brainchild of artist André Heller, Luna Luna first opened in 1987 in Hamburg, Germany, as a spectacular fairground. And then, by a twist of fate, the park’s treasures were forgotten in storage in Texas for 36 years. With a blockbuster showing in Los Angeles in December 2023, Luna Luna: Forgotten Fantasy resurrected these artworks, to audiences’ delight.
